"' Ciro Pessoa Mendes Corr阛 "'( born June 12, 1957 ), also known by his Dharma name "'Tenzin Ch鰌el "', is a Brazilian singer-songwriter, guitarist, screenwriter, journalist, writer, activist and poet, famous for being one of the founding members of the influential rock band Tit鉺 and for his later work with pioneering post-punk / gothic rock band Cabine C . He also formed numerous other short-lived and lesser known projects in the mid-1980s / 1990s before beginning a solo career in 2003.
